Output 159e9665595b3ece8c414627e6f0abd95b12a1989bb8ee841ba61301667a453d:0

value
16000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a0fd3c02e537a75d99dc85f1fdc2d9a5fb396fd OP_EQUAL
address
35XRGHo5RBFvZfHYqnigd4puS4Yt6rjHk6
transaction
159e9665595b3ece8c414627e6f0abd95b12a1989bb8ee841ba61301667a453d
spent
true